Kako namestiti in uporabljati Keel v Linuxu Optimizirajte za optimizacijo zapletenih algoritmov podatkovnega rudarjenja

Kako Namestiti In Uporabljati Keel V Linuxu Optimizirajte Za Optimizacijo Zapletenih Algoritmov Podatkovnega Rudarjenja



Kobilica (Knowledge Extraction based on Evolutionary Learning) je programsko orodje, ki temelji na Javi in ​​je specializirano za implementacijo evolucijskih algoritmov. Ker je odprtokoden, ponuja široko paleto algoritmov za odkrivanje znanja, ki jih je mogoče uporabiti v poskusih, ki poganjajo skupnost podatkovnega rudarjenja in analize. Zagotavlja preprost in za uporabo enostaven grafični uporabniški vmesnik, ki znatno zmanjša celotno kompleksnost tega orodja. Večina podobnih orodij na trgu zahteva, da uporabniki komunicirajo z njimi tako, da napišejo kodo, medtem ko Keel to zahtevo odpravi z zagotavljanjem intuitivnega GUI, ki ga lahko uporabljajo tako začetniki kot strokovnjaki.

Keel ponuja široko paleto različnih algoritmov, ki temeljijo na računalniški inteligenci, vključno s klasifikacijo, regresijo, ekstrakcijo značilnosti, analizo vzorcev, združevanjem v gruče in več. Z glavnimi modeli, ki so vpeti neposredno v samo aplikacijo, je Keel zelo uporabno orodje, ko gre za izvajanje raziskovalnih analiz podatkov na nizih neobdelanih podatkov. Njegov preprost vmesnik povleci in spusti skupaj z enostavno uporabo funkcionalnosti omogoča hitro in učinkovito eksperimentiranje s podatkovnim rudarjenjem za izobraževalne in raziskovalne namene. Orodja, kot je Keel, postajajo vse bolj priljubljena zaradi njihovega poenostavljenega pristopa k sicer zapletenim algoritemskim praksam.







Namestitev

Obstajata dva glavna načina namestitve Kobilica na kateri koli napravi Linux. Prvi vključuje odhod v Spletna stran Keel in od tam prenesete programsko opremo. Drugi, ki ga bomo spremljali v tem priročniku za namestitev, zahteva, da prenesemo Keel z uporabo wget orodje za prenos, ki je na voljo uporabnikom Linuxa.



1. Začnemo tako, da dobimo wget na našem računalniku Linux.



Zaženite naslednji ukaz za prenos wget z uporabo apt upravitelj paketov:





$ sudo apt-get namestitev wget

Videli boste podoben izhod terminala:



2. Zdaj, ko imamo wget orodje, nameščeno na našem računalniku Linux, ga uporabljamo za prenos Kobilica orodje.

To je povezava ki ga posredujemo v wget.

V terminalu zaženite naslednji ukaz:

$ wget http: // sci2s.ugr.es / kobilica / programsko opremo / prototipi / openVersion / Programska oprema- 2018 -04-09.zip

Na terminalu bi morali videti podoben izpis:

Ko je Keel končan s prenosom, lahko nadaljujemo s preostalim delom namestitve.

3. Zdaj ekstrahiramo stisnjeno datoteko, ki smo jo prenesli v prejšnjem koraku, z orodjem Linux Razpakiraj.

Zaženite naslednji ukaz:

$ razpakirati Programska oprema- 2018 -04-09.zip

V terminalu bi morali videti podoben rezultat:

4. Pomaknite se do mape Keel tako, da zaženete naslednji ukaz:

$ cd Programska oprema- 2018 -04-09 / dokumenti / poskusi / KOBILICA / dist /

5. Za začetek namestitve zaženite naslednji ukaz:

$ java -kozarec . / GraphInterKeel.jar

S tem bi moral biti Keel na voljo za uporabo na vašem računalniku Linux.

Navodila

Interakcija z Kobilica aplikacija je res enostavna in enostavna. Začnimo z uvozom Niz podatkov o šarenici v naš delovni prostor.

Ko uvozimo podatke, nam orodje prikaže celotno združevanje podatkovne točke v naboru podatkov. Pokaže nam tudi različne razrede, ki so prisotni v naboru podatkov, skupaj z osnovnimi informacijami, kot so številčni obsegi, ki jih te podatkovne točke zajemajo, ter skupna varianca in srednje vrednosti, ki jih predstavljajo. Te informacije omogočajo uporabnikom, da bolje razumejo, kako nadaljevati s pripravo podatkov za kakršno koli nalogo analize podatkov.


Ko gremo naprej v eksperimentiranje, naletimo na različne tehnike, ki jih lahko uporabimo za ustvarjanje našega eksperimenta na katerem koli nizu podatkov. Različne učne algoritme, ki jih je mogoče uporabiti za naše podatke, lahko vidite na naslednji sliki. Glede na naravo nabora podatkov in zahteve poskusa je mogoče eksperimentirati z različnimi algoritmi.

Če na primer delate z neoznačenimi podatki in morate poiskati podobnosti med različnimi podatkovnimi točkami v vašem naboru podatkov, vam lahko uporaba algoritma združevanja v gruče iz različnih razpoložljivih možnosti pomaga bolje razumeti podatkovne točke. To vam sčasoma pomaga pri označevanju in razvrščanju podatkovnih točk, tako da lahko eksperiment nadgradite z uporabo obsežnejših algoritmov za nadzorovano učenje.

Zaključek

The Kobilica platforma za podatkovno analitiko je dober vir tako za raziskovalne kot izobraževalne namene. Grafični uporabniški vmesnik, ki je enostaven za uporabo, pomaga uporabnikom, da bolje razumejo zahteve podatkov, skupaj z zagotavljanjem logičnih sklicev na koristne tehnike in algoritme, ki dodatno pomagajo uporabnikom pri njihovih delovnih tokovih. Širok nabor različnih algoritmov, ki spadajo v različne kategorije in algoritemske tehnike, uporabnikom omogoča eksperimentiranje s številnimi logičnimi usmeritvami in primerjavo teh rezultatov, tako da je mogoče doseči najbolj optimalno rešitev za kateri koli problem.

Keelov pristop povleci in spusti brez kode k podatkovnemu rudarjenju pomaga tudi začetnikom, da brez truda delajo z obsežnimi modeli računalniške inteligence. To zagotavlja vpogled v zapletene nize podatkov in posledično izpelje uporabne sklepe, ki pomagajo pri reševanju težav v resničnem svetu.